On 2010-11-20 13:36, Yeb Havinga wrote:
> On 2010-11-20 04:46, Robert Haas wrote:
>> Well, the problem with just comparing on<  is that it takes very
>> little account of the upper bounds.  I think the cases where a simple
>> split would hurt you the most are those where examining the upper
>> bound is necessary to to get a good split.
> With the current 8K default blocksize, I put my money on the sorting 
> algorithm for any seg case. The r-tree algorithm's performance is 
> probably more influenced by large buckets->low tree depth->generic 
> keys on non leaf nodes.
To test this conjecture I compared a default 9.0.1 postgres (with 
debugging) to exactly the same postgres but with an 1K blocksize, with 
the test that Alexander posted upthread.

8K blocksize:
postgres=# create index seg_test_idx on seg_test using gist (a);
CREATE INDEX
Time: 99613.308 ms
SELECT
Total runtime: 81.482 ms

1K blocksize:
CREATE INDEX
Time: 40113.252 ms
SELECT
Total runtime: 3.363 ms

Details of explain analyze are below. The rowcount results are not 
exactly the same because I forgot to backup the first test, so created 
new random data.
Though I didn't compare the sorting picksplit this way, I suspect that 
that algorithm won't be effected so much by the difference in blocksize.
